Output 3e59b18772ac44faf428e2a49c41f1f5399fe19cabb6336c9b6765b03416a245:3

value
442964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83467961c2d94d980e40addcdb066a6a8c21bc8c OP_EQUAL
address
3Df8sJYALGPiMWwzsiT6TQDQCqa5nndGH8
transaction
3e59b18772ac44faf428e2a49c41f1f5399fe19cabb6336c9b6765b03416a245
spent
true